Answer:

Y =116

Step-by-step explanation:

We know that angle Z = angle X since they are base angles  and  the sides are the same length

The sum of the angles of a triangle are 180

X+Y+Z = 180

32+ Y + 32 = 180

64+Y=180

Y = 180-64

Y =116
